Exploring The Versatility Of Laser Cutters

Laser cutters are powerful and versatile machines that are used in various industries for a wide range of applications These machines use a high-powered laser beam to cut through materials with precision and accuracy The laser beam is guided by a computer-controlled system, allowing for intricate designs and shapes to be cut with ease Let’s take a closer look at what laser cutters are used for and the benefits they offer.

One of the most common uses of laser cutters is in the manufacturing industry These machines are used to cut and shape a wide variety of materials, including metal, plastic, wood, and glass Laser cutters are capable of cutting through thick materials with ease, making them ideal for producing complex parts and components The precision and accuracy of laser cutters ensure that each piece is cut to exact specifications, reducing waste and increasing efficiency in the manufacturing process.

In the world of design and art, laser cutters have revolutionized the way artists and designers create their work These machines allow for intricate and detailed designs to be cut with precision, opening up a world of possibilities for creative expression Artists and designers can use laser cutters to create custom pieces, prototypes, and even large-scale installations The speed and accuracy of laser cutters make them a valuable tool for any creative project.

Another important application of laser cutters is in the medical industry These machines are used to cut and shape materials for medical devices, implants, and prosthetics The precision of laser cutters ensures that each device is made to exact specifications, ensuring the safety and effectiveness of the final product Laser cutters are also used in surgery, where they can be used to cut through tissue with precision and accuracy, reducing the risk of complications.

These machines are capable of cutting through tough materials such as titanium and composites, making them ideal for producing lightweight and durable parts Laser cutters are used to create intricate components for aircraft engines, wings, and other critical systems The precision and speed of laser cutters help to reduce production time and costs, making them an essential tool in the aerospace industry.

In the field of architecture and construction, laser cutters are used to create detailed models, prototypes, and custom components Architects and designers use laser cutters to bring their designs to life, creating intricate models and prototypes with precision and accuracy Laser cutters can cut through a wide range of materials, including cardboard, wood, and acrylic, making them a versatile tool for any architectural project The speed and efficiency of laser cutters help to streamline the design and fabrication process, saving time and money for architects and builders.

Laser cutters are also used in the automotive industry to cut and shape materials for cars, trucks, and other vehicles These machines are used to create precision parts and components for engines, chassis, and body panels Laser cutters are capable of cutting through thick materials quickly and accurately, making them an essential tool for automotive manufacturers The speed and accuracy of laser cutters help to improve production efficiency and quality control in the automotive industry.
